Normally, automated search bots index public web pages. However, if a user sets up a private cloud server (such as Nextcloud, OwnCloud, or a personal NAS device) and forgets to disable directory listing, search engine crawlers will catalog every single image.

: It is a massive privacy breach. Personal metadata (EXIF data) attached to photos in these DCIM folders often includes GPS coordinates , the exact time the photo was taken, and device serial numbers.
